Genshin Impact 5.6 is finally here, and with it comes a brand-new character plus a slate of powerful re-runs. Whether you’re a new player or a veteran, choosing who to pull for can feel overwhelming, especially with Primogems on the line. Here's an easy guide to help you decide which character banners are actually worth it in Version 5.6.

1. Escoffier – Cryo Utility Queen Stats: New 5-star | Cryo | Polearm | Sub-DPS/Support
Escoffier is the breakout star of 5.6. Her kit offers powerful Cryo and Hydro resistance shred, making her ideal for Freeze or mono-element comps. But what sets her apart? She heals while supporting — a rare combo that opens doors for synergy with high-risk, high-reward characters like Ayaka or Neuvillette.
Why pull?
- Insane support value for Cryo/Hydro comps
- Solid healing = less reliance on dedicated healers
- Future-proof team flexibility
- You run (or want to run) Freeze teams
- You have Ayaka, Neuvillette, or Furina
2. Navia – Geo’s DPS Darling Stats: Re-run | Geo | Claymore | Main DPS
Navia returns, and she’s still as lethal as ever. With massive Geo bursts and flexible team-building potential, she fits into most rosters with ease. The best part? She doesn’t need constellations to shine. Equip her with a good Crit Rate build and let her rip.
Why pull?
- Powerful and beginner-friendly
- Great with supports like Furina, Zhongli, Bennett
- Works even at low investment
- You need a main DPS
- You enjoy Geo or flexible team comps
Kinich is flashy, fun, and full of potential — but he’s not for everyone. His strength lies in Burning and Burgeon teams, which means he needs specific support units to truly pop. If you have those? You’re golden. If not? He may underwhelm.
Why pull?
- Great Spiral Abyss DPS
- Fits into elemental reaction teams
- Can delete bosses if built right
- You already have key supports like Nahida, Xiangling
- You enjoy reaction-based playstyles
